The Assessor is required by the Louisiana Constitution to discover, list and value all property subject to ad valorem taxation on the assessment roll each year. In early April, the Port of South Louisiana approved a deal that would allow an agriculture export company to avoid paying just over $200 million in property taxes on a grain terminal planned in St. John the Baptist Parish. ACI St. John, LLC administers all of the functions of sales and use tax collections in the Parish, and as such, should be the first contact for sales and use tax related matters. St. Tammany Parish collects the highest property tax in Louisiana, levying an average of $1,335.00 (0.66% of median home value) yearly in property taxes, while St. Landry Parish has the lowest property tax in the state, collecting an average tax of $202.00 (0.25% of median home value) per year.
